The proposed project consists of improvements to the NC 109 corridor in Davidson and Forsyth Counties,
south of the city of Winston-Salem. This statement documents the need for improvements to the existing
corridor and evaluates alternatives with respect to costs and social, economic, and environmental
impacts. A Preferred Alternative will be selected based on the findings of this study, an evaluation of
comments received on this document, and comments received at the Public Hearing.
